Meaning of "headbox"
A 'headbox' is a mechanical device used in various industries, such as papermaking, to distribute a consistent flow of material. It typically ensures uniform distribution onto a moving surface for further processing

- Synonym of headrail
- A device for distributing a suspension of solids in water to a machine at a constant rate, or for retarding the rate of flow, as to a top-feed filter, or for eliminating by overflow some of the finest particles.
- The topmost square of a USPSA target holding the B and A scoring zones.
